Ben Jacobson

Ben Jacobson is an American basketball coach, currently the head coach at Utah State University since 2026. Before this role, he was the head coach at the University of Northern Iowa from 2006 to 2026. Prior to becoming a head coach, Jacobson served as an assistant coach at North Dakota, North Dakota State, and Northern Iowa, gaining experience before taking the helm at Northern Iowa in 2006.

December 16, 1970: Ben Jacobson's Birth

On December 16, 1970, Ben Scott Jacobson was born. He is an American basketball coach.

1989: North Dakota Mr. Basketball

In 1989, after his senior year at Mayville-Portland High School, Ben Jacobson was named North Dakota Mr. Basketball and started playing collegiately at the University of North Dakota.

1993: College Career Ends

In 1993, Ben Jacobson ended his college basketball career at the University of North Dakota as the school's all-time assist leader.

2001: Panthers Top Assistant Coach

In 2001, Jacobson became the Panthers' top assistant coach, playing a key role in the team's development.

2006: Head Coach at University of Northern Iowa

In 2006, Ben Jacobson became the head coach at University of Northern Iowa.

2006: NCAA Tournament and Top-25 Ranking

In 2006, UNI advanced to the NCAA tournament and achieved its first-ever Division I top-25 ranking.

August 2007: Team USA at World University Games

In August 2007, Jacobson coached UNI as it represented the United States at the World University Games in Bangkok, Thailand, going 5–1 in the tournament.

2009: Sweet Sixteen Run

In 2009, Jacobson's Panthers made a run into the Sweet Sixteen of the NCAA tournament, upsetting top national seed Kansas.

March 2010: Contract Extension with UNI

In March 2010, Jacobson signed a 10-year extension with UNI, guaranteeing him $450,000 a year with annual increases of $25,000.

2010: Continued Success with the Panthers

In the 2010 season, Jacobson led the Panthers to their eighth consecutive 18-plus win season, third straight postseason bid and a Valley-leading third straight 20-plus win season.

November 15, 2014: All-Time Win Leader

On November 15, 2014, Ben Jacobson became the all-time win leader for a coach in UNI Men's basketball history, recording his 167th UNI victory.

2014: Highest Ranking in School History

In the 2014 season, Jacobson led the Panthers to their highest ranking in school history (#10 in AP and #9 in Coaches Poll) and achieved the most wins in school's history with 31.

November 21, 2015: Victory Over #1 North Carolina

On November 21, 2015, Jacobson led UNI to a victory over #1 North Carolina.

March 6, 2016: MVC Tournament Win

On March 6, 2016, UNI won its fourth MVC tournament under Jacobson.

March 1, 2018: 250th Career Win

On March 1, 2018, Jacobson notched his 250th Northern Iowa career win against Evansville in the first round of the MVC tournament.

March 5, 2020: MVC Coach of the Year

On March 5, 2020, Ben Jacobson was named MVC coach of the year.

February 27, 2021: 300th Career Victory

On February 27, 2021, Ben Jacobson earned his 300th career Northern Iowa victory with a double overtime win over Illinois State.

March 3, 2022: MVC Coach of the Year Award

On March 3, 2022, Jacobson was named the MVC coach of the year for the 5th time, giving him the most coach of the year award honors in the 115-year history of Missouri Valley Conference.

January 20, 2024: All-Time Conference Wins Leader

On January 20, 2024, Jacobson became the all-time conference wins leader (188) in Missouri Valley Conference history with a victory over rival Southern Illinois.
